Alhaji Muhammadu Besse, a former Chairman of the All Progressives Congress (APC) in Koko Besse Local Government Area of Kebbi State, has died while in captivity.

The former party official had been abducted alongside his friend, Muhammed Maibarga, earlier in June. Maibarga, who served as an Islamic cleric with the Jama’atu Izalatil Bid’ah wa Ikamatis-Sunnah (JIBWIS), reportedly died in captivity three weeks ago.

Prior to their deaths, bandits released a video showing the late Besse and his cleric friend being tortured and humiliated inside the forest.

When contacted, the Public Relations Officer of the Kebbi State Police Command, SP Bashir Usman, stated that the police is still investigating the death of the former party chairman.
